Bank of the West Platinum Credit Card Features

The most important feature of the Bank of The West Platinum Credit Card is the fact that it has been designed for people carrying a balance on their accounts. If you have this card, it could be to your advantage in the instances where you need to prove that you have a balance on your account.

As the card is a MasterCard you’ll also share in the normal MasterCard benefits. These benefits include security protection like 24/7 fraud monitoring and identity theft resolution. For your peace of mind, it also offers you zero liability for fraudulent transactions.

Its SecureSuite provides you with price protection and extended warranty benefits. When needed, you can very easily utilize the online management tool to temporarily lock or unlock your card in the event of theft, or when you want to conduct a balance transfer.

Pros and Cons of the Bank of the West Platinum Credit Card

Pros

Apart from the features mentioned above, your Bank of the West Credit Card has other advantages as well. To begin with, it offers a card with no annual fee and low-interest rates.

The card has a lower interest rate than most other credit cards. Another rate-related pro is its 0% intro APR for 6 months. After the initial 6 months, the APR will be between 14.99% – 22.99%, which is still lower as the most other cards.

Cons

One of the cons that the Platinum Credit Card has is that it is not for everyone. If you have a not-so-good credit history and need a lot of credit, this card is most probably not for you.

The card also has a rather high penalty rate for late payments and returned payment transactions. For both, you could be penalized with an amount of up to $38 per transaction.

Bank of the West Platinum Credit Card Fees

Let’s look at specific fees and rates that are charged on Bank of the West Platinum Credit Card below.

  • Sign-Up Fee: $0
  • Annual Fee: $0
  • Interest Rate: Variable
  • APR: 0% intro APR for 6 months, and then 14.99% – 22.99% variable APR for purchases.
  • APR for Balance Transfer: 14.99%to 22.99% based on creditworthiness
  • APR for Cash Advances: 24.99%
  • Balance Transfer Rate: $10 or 4% of the transferred amount, whichever amount is greater
  • Cash Advance Fee: $10 or 4% of the advanced amount, whichever amount is greater
  • Foreign Transaction Fee: 3% of the U.S. dollar amount of each transaction
  • Penalty for Late Payment: Up to $38 per transaction, variable
  • Penalty for Returned Payment: Up to $38 per transaction, variable

Credit Card Eligibility

To qualify for a Bank of the West Platinum Credit Card you have to be a US resident and 18 years or older. A good credit history would enhance the chances for approval.
